Basic Attributes (External Port)

In this user interface, you can query and set basic attributes of a MAC port.

Navigation Path

In the NE Explorer, click the board and choose Configuration > Ethernet Interface Management > Ethernet Interface from the Function Tree. Click the External Port and then click Basic Attributes tab.

Parameters

Field

Value

Description

Port

PORTn

For example: PORT3

Displays all the PORT ports that the Ethernet board can use. The value n indicates the PORT port number.

Enabled/Disabled

Enabled, Disabled

Default: Disabled

Enabled means that the user uses this port and the service is available. Disabled means that the services at this port are not handled. Hence, you need to enable the port that you want to use when configuring services.

Working Mode

For example: Auto-Negotiation

Displays the working modes of the Ethernet port. Auto-Negotiation can automatically determine the optimized working modes of the connected ports. This mode is easy to maintain and is recommended.

During configuration, make sure that working modes of the connected ports are consistent. If the working modes are different, the services are down.

Max. Frame Length (bytes)

For example: 1518

The Max. Frame Length (bytes) (Ethernet Port Attribute) parameter specifies the maximum frame length that is supported at an Ethernet port.
MAC Loopback

Non-Loopback, Inloop, Outloop

Default: Non-Loopback

The MAC Loopback (Ethernet Port Attribute) parameter specifies the MAC loopback state at an Ethernet port. Port loopback setting is applied to locating faults only.
PHY Loopback

Non-Loopback, Inloop, Outloop

Default: Non-Loopback

The PHY Loopback (Ethernet Port Attribute) parameter specifies the PHY loopback state at an Ethernet port. Port loopback setting is applied to locating faults only.

Physical Type

Reported value by query

Displays the physical type of port.

Logic Type

SDH-OPPORT, SDH-EPORT

Displays the logic type of port.

Port UP/DOWN Status UP, DOWN Queries the physical link connectivity of the port.
